Hurricane Helene Strikes Clemson

Clemson, South Carolina  September 27, 2024

On Friday, September 27, 2024, Clemson faced the destructive forces of Hurricane Helene, a storm that left behind significant damage and widespread power outages. High winds and torrential rains toppled trees, flooded roadways, and caused devastation throughout our community.
